Danielle Teller

    Danielle Teller ha perseguito il suo sogno di una vita di scrivere dopo una carriera nella ricerca medica e accademica. Il suo lavoro approfondisce le complessità delle relazioni umane e il tessuto delle esperienze di vita. La scrittura di Teller è caratterizzata da una profonda risonanza emotiva e dall'esplorazione di dilemmi etici. Cerca di catturare le sfumate realtà della condizione umana.

    All the Ever Afters
    • In a luminous reimagining of a classic tale, the story unfolds from the perspective of Agnes, Cinderella’s "evil" stepmother. As rumors swirl about the cruel upbringing of Princess Cinderella, Agnes, who has faced her own hardships, records the true story. Born into serfdom, she is separated from her family and forced into servitude as a laundress’s apprentice at just ten. Using her wits, she escapes her tyrannical matron, seeking a hopeful future. However, when a teenage Agnes is seduced by an older man and becomes pregnant, her love for her child transforms her. Left penniless again, she returns to servitude at the manor, now as the nursemaid to Ella, an enchanting infant. Agnes struggles to love the child who becomes her stepdaughter and ultimately the celebrated princess, embodying unattainable fantasies. Their relationship reveals that appearances can be deceiving, beauty is not always a blessing, and love can manifest in various forms. Lyrically told and emotionally evocative, this narrative delves into the complexities beneath classic tales of good and evil, illustrating that how we confront adversity reveals deeper truths than the notion of "happily ever after."
